Keep her or sell her? Opinions needed! 850 1996

A few comments:

1. Does the alignment pass spec, or is something bent? Your suspension issues are abnormal.
2. Your continuing A/C problems do not make sense. A replacement evaporator should last many years at least.
3. Volvos do eat brakes, but your prices and frequency sounds high. Figure on new front pads every 25-30k, new front rotors every 50-60k. The rear brakes may get double this.
4. Many of the other items you mention are, unfortunately, common repairs (ABS, horn contacts).

If the suspension and alignment are gone, start shopping for a new car. What else can go wrong? Maybe the tranny. Yes, you can maintain the 850 for longer (and cheaper than a new car), but what is the nuisance factor worth to you?
